Full recipe:
Coffee, Grapefruit and Pomegranate Mocktail
Yield: 2
Author: Nicole Hough
Ingredients
- Juice of half a grapefruit
- 1/2 c brewed coffee, cooled
- 1/2 c pomegranate juice
- 1 tsp Maraschino cherry juice
- 1 tsp Malt Barley Extract Syrup or molasses
Instructions
- Use a peeler to remove two large swaths of grapefruit peel to use for garnish, set aside
- Juice grapefruit
- Add grapefruit juice and remaining ingredients to shaker
- Stir without ice to dissolve syrup
- Add ice to shaker and shake
- Strain into a coupe or martini glass
- Garnish with grapefruit peel twist and maraschino cherries
